Output 8e996d66e14b82b90559ec00d9cda3e0ca92eafaa9edd46e3d6e08efeafb64fb:3

value
328941201
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289babefe2ad1c1fcff1c7ea448af17e919d1c50 OP_EQUALVERIFY OP_CHECKSIG
address
14hiWvoYaNUrXGmR4s4GpCxDr3inUxRJX5
transaction
8e996d66e14b82b90559ec00d9cda3e0ca92eafaa9edd46e3d6e08efeafb64fb
confirmations
309724
spent
true